Abstract
he present investigation entitled "Genetic variability
analysis and morphological characterization of rabi sorghum
[Sorghum bicolor (L.) Moench] germplasms" was carried out at
Sorghum Improvement Project, M.P.K.V., Rahuri (M.S.) during
rabi 2003, to study the extent of genetic variability in the rabi
sorghum germplasm, to characterize the germplasm on the basis
of morphological characters and to isolate the desirable ideotypes
for the breeding purpose.
An experimental material consist of 550 different
germplasm of rabi sorghum available with Senior Sorghum
Breeder, Sorghum Improvement Project, M.P.K.V., Rahuri. 550
genotypes of rabi sorghum were grown in Augmented
Randomized Block Design with two checks i.e. M-35-1 and CSV
216 in 22 blocks. The observations were recorded on plant, leaf, panicle,
flowers and seed morphological characters. The morphological
characteristics exhibited by different varieties studied indicated
that although some of the cultivars have common morphological
features in respect of one or few characters, they can be
differentiated from each other on the basis of other characters.
Plant morphological characters like plant colour (tan
and nontan), days of 50 per cent flowering (early, medium and
late), days to maturity (early, medium and late), plant height
(short, medium and tall), internode length, number of internodes
per plant, number of leaves per plant were studied. Leaf
characters like midrib colour, leaf sheath waxiness, leaf margin
shape, flag leaf angle, leaf position angle, leaf sheath covering,
leaf length, leaf width were also studied and characterized.
Panicle characters like panicle shape, peduncle length, earhead
length, earhead width and seed characters like seed shape, seed
size, seed luster, 1000 seed weight and grain yield per plant were
also studied. Genotypes exhibited differences for these
characters.
Sufficient variability was present in germplasm under
study for all characters. Magnitude of PCV was found more than
GCV for all characters.
The heritability in broad sense for growth characters
1000 seed weight, grain yield, number of leaves per plant, leaf width, internode length, peduncle length and earhead length was
highest. High heritability accompanied with high genetic advance
was observed for growth traits viz., grain yield, 1000 grain
weight, number of leaves per plant, earhead length, leaf width,
internode length, peduncle length and plant height suggesting
additive gene control in the inheritance of these traits and scope
for selection in the improvement of these characters. On the
basis of superiority of the different genotypes over better check
some genotypes are isolated and suggested for further
improvement programme of rabi sorghum.
